Board President – MetroED Foundation
Jessica Geary is the Board President for the MetroED Foundation. She started her corporate career at Xilinx, Inc. (now AMD) as a HR Specialist focused on global mobility and immigration.  She broadened her HR experience adding in HR compliance, specifically in policies and procedures, Form I-9s, and Affirmative Action.  In 2015, she moved into global benefits and created the Global Wellbeing Program serving 4,000+ employees. In 2022, she started in a new role as Human Resources Director at Technology Credit Union with a focus on HR Operations. 
Jessica is also a Girl Scout leader for her daughter’s troop, going on her sixth year.  She enjoys being a mentor to young women, teaching leadership skills and sisterhood.  Additionally, she served the Union School District as a Project Cornerstone volunteer on and off for four years.  She enjoyed teaching young students the values of empathy and respect. 
 
Jessica serves on the MetroEd Foundation Board because the Silicon Valley Career Technical Education school (SVCTE) positively impacts her community and family.  Many of her family members attended SVCTE, including her father, mother, aunt, brothers, sister, cousins, nephew, and her son. She’s seen first-hand how the skills they’ve learned have given them many options for employment in high-paying and successful careers.
